VANILLA COGNAC CREPES
A splash of Cognac adds warmth to these basic vanilla crepes. Try them with sautéed apples and a drizzle of caramel sauce.
Provided by Cucina Casalingo
Categories Dessert
Time 55m
Yield 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Whisk all the ingredients vigorously until the crepe batter is completely smooth; allow it to rest in the refrigerator for at least 20 minutes before making into crepes.
- Melt a little butter in a crepe pan or large skillet over low-medium heat.
- Add 3 tablespoons of batter to the pan and swirl until the bottom of the pan is covered with batter.
- Cook the crepe for 1 minute, or until the crepe is slightly moist on top and golden underneath.
- Loosen the edges of the crepe, slide the spatula under it, and then gently flip it upside down into the pan.
- Cook for 1 minute and transfer the cooked crepe to a plate to keep warm.
- Repeat with the remaining batter.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 112, Fat 4.8, SaturatedFat 2.6, Cholesterol 62.6, Sodium 118.8, Carbohydrate 12.8, Fiber 0.4, Sugar 0.2, Protein 3.7

DEVILED PECANS
These spicy little devils are delicious! Betcha can't eat just one. One of my Mother's specialties for snacking.
Provided by BeachGirl
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 25m
Yield 4 cups, 16 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Place pecans in single layer in large baking sheet.
- Add all spices and worcestershire to melted butter.
- Pour over pecans and stir to coat evenly.
- Bake 20 minutes in 300 degree oven, stirring several times during baking.
- STORAGE: Store pecans in an air-tight container.
- These can be frozen and keep for months.

THE 30 BEST COGNAC COCKTAIL RECIPES - COGNAC EXPERT BLOG
From blog.cognac-expert.com
Estimated Reading Time 6 mins
- Alba. 3 cl Cognac. 2 cl orange juice. 1 cl raspberry juice. Slice of orange. Ice cubes. Place the Cognac, orange juice, and rasperry juice in the shaker, together with the ice cubes, and shake!
- Alexander Cocktail made with Cognac. 4 cl Cognac. 3 cl Crème de Cacao. 3 cl cream. Cacao powder or muscat. Ice cubes. Fill the shaker with ice, Cognac, crème, and cream.
- Arago Cognac Cocktail. 2 cl Cognac. 2 cl Crème de Banane. A little crème fraîche. Syrup. Ice cubes. Putt the ice cubes into the shaker, then the other ingredients.
- Banana Bliss. 2 cl Cognac. 2 cl Crème de Banane. Ice cubes. Put two ice cubes and the other ingredients into a mixing glass. Stir well, then and into a tumbler glass to serve.
- Between The Sheets (A Classic) 3 cl Cognac. 3 cl white Rum. 3 cl Cointreau. 3 cl lemon juice. 1 slice of lemon. Crushed ice. Shake ingredients together with the crushed ice, pour into glass, and decorate with the lemon slice.
- Beverly Hills. 2cl Cognac. 4 cl Triple sec. 1 cl Kalhua (Coffee liqueur) Ice cubes. Place all ingredients in shaker, mix well – pour into a cocktail glass.
- Bomber. 4 cl Cognac. 2 cl Vodka. 2 cl Cointreau. Ice cubes. Mix all ingredients together and serve on ice.
- Bora Bora. 2 cl Cognac. 2 cl Vodka. 2 cl Cherry brandy. 2 cl Picon (French aperitif) Ice cubes. Mix all ingredients and serve in a cocktail glass.
- Brandy Daisy. 2 cl Cognac. Juice of 1/2 a lemon. Splash of Grenadine. Sparkling water. Ice cubes. Put ice cubes, Cognac, and lemon juice into the shaker. Add a tiny bit of Grenadine and shake well.
- Baltimore Egg Nogg. 3 cl Cognac. 4,5 cl Madeira. 1,5 cl Jamaica Rum. 2 teaspoons sugar syrup. 1 egg. 6 cl crème. 120 ml of milk. Muscat. Ice cubes. Put all ingredients except the milk and Muscat into shaker.
